Women’s World Cup: Lauren James Apologizes To Alozie Over Stepping Episode

England’s female player, Lauren James has given an apology to Nigeria’s Super Bird of prey, Michelle Alozie over a stepping episode during the Monday match.

Lauren had procured herself a red card for trampling the rear of Alozie as she rose to her feet following an intense impact between them towards the finish of guideline time.

Responding, football darlings had censured Lauren for the occurrence, savaging and contrasting the demonstration with that of David Beckham in 1998 and Wayne Rooney in 2006, who represented England’s men group.

Ending her quietness, Lauren offered a conciliatory sentiment to Alozie by means of Twitter on Tuesday.

She remarked under a tweet made by Alozie, encouraging fans to quit savaging Lauren.

“All my love and respect to you. I am sorry for what happened. Also, for our England fans and team-mates, playing with you and for you is my greatest honour and I promise to learn from this experience.”

England crushed Nigeria 4-2 through a penalty shootout on Monday.
